TFR: This Feels Right welcomes Geni Whitehouse,a TEDx Napa Valley speaker, Founder at The Impactful Advisor, CPA, and self-proclaimed nerd who believes there’s magic in the numbers.

I first saw Geni presenting at a conference in Arizona, where she captivated the room with her authentic voice and engaging stories—especially her humorous take on wine pairings like, “Does bacon go with that?" empowering professionals to connect deeply with their audiences and clients.

✨ 3 Key Takeaways:

1. Authenticity Wins: Why being yourself is your biggest asset, whether presenting or connecting with others.

2. Find the One: How focusing on just one listener who needs your message can transform your confidence and impact.

3. Humor as a Bridge: The magic of using stories and humor to break down barriers and resonate with any crowd.

And Geni is also a co-founder of Solve Services, author of How to Make a Boring Subject Interesting: 52 Ways Even a Nerd Can Be Heard, and the countess of communication at Brotemarkle, Davis & Co. and Even a Nerd Can Be Heard.⁠⁠
